A low drag and high lift sail has a fabric skin suspended by an edge tension device able to control forward and trailing edge tension to tune and reverse the airfoil section. The fabric skin is double, with a windward and lee section of different curvatures giving the airfoil section thickness. The sail is supported by a mast and a curved boom located between the two fabric sections and thus is out of the impinging air stream. The ends of the boom are used for the sail support, usually with an additional external spar or spars on the windward side. The mast includes a foot which is either fixed or attached by a universal joint to a craft for motive power.
